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films Market Outlook

The global Biaxially Oriented Polyamide (BOPA) Laminating Films market is projected to reach USD 1.09 billion by 2035, with a robust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 6.5%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th can be attributed to the rising demand for durable and flexible packaging solutions across various sectors, including food, pharmaceuticals, and industrial applications. The expanding e-commerce industry is also contributing significantly to the market as it seeks high-quality packaging solutions that ensure product integrity during storage and transportation. Moreover, the increasing consumer awareness regarding sustainable and eco-friendly packaging materials is pushing manufacturers to innovate and develop BOPA films that meet these demands. Additionally, the need for effective barrier properties in packaging solutions is driving the adoption of BOPA laminating films in several applications, further fueling market expansion.

By Product Type

Regular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films:

Regular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films are widely used in various applications due to their balanced properties of strength, flexibility, and barrier performance. These films are particularly favored in the food packaging industry, where product freshness is critical. They offer moderate gas and moisture barrier properties, making them suitable for packaging items such as snacks and dry foods. Additionally, regular BOPA films are often employed in industrial applications where mechanical strength and durability are essential. The versatility of these films allows manufacturers to tailor their properties through formulations and processing techniques, further enhancing their applicability across diverse sectors.

High Barrier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films:

High Barrier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films are engineered to provide superior protection against oxygen, moisture, and light, making them ideal for sensitive products, including pharmaceuticals and perishable food items. These films are critical in extending the shelf life of products by minimizing spoilage and retaining freshness. The increased adoption of high barrier films is driven by the growing demand for packaging solutions that offer enhanced shelf life with minimal preservatives. Furthermore, advancements in film technology have resulted in the development of high barrier films that can be produced thinner while maintaining their protective properties, providing economic and environmental benefits.

Low Barrier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films:

Low Barrier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films are designed for applications where moisture and oxygen barriers are not critical. These films are generally more cost-effective and suitable for packaging non-perishable goods, such as dry snacks and certain industrial products. Their popularity stems from their lightweight nature and ease of processing, which allows for more efficient packaging solutions. Additionally, they can be laminated with other materials to enhance specific properties without significantly increasing costs, providing manufacturers with flexible options for their packaging needs.

Metallized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films:

Metallized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films feature a thin layer of metal, usually aluminum, which significantly enhances their barrier properties against light, moisture, and gases. This feature makes them particularly valuable in the food packaging sector, where they are used to package items that require protection from environmental factors. The metallized aspect also adds a decorative look to the packaging, making it visually appealing to consumers. As the demand for premium packaging solutions grows, so does the popularity of metallized films, especially in sectors where product appearance is as important as product safety.

Retort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films:

Retort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films are specialized films designed for use in retort pouches, which are often employed for ready-to-eat meals and other heat-treated food products. These films can withstand high temperatures and maintain their integrity during the sterilization process, ensuring that the packaged food is safe for consumption. The increasing trend of convenience foods is driving the demand for retort films as they allow for longer shelf life and easy storage. Manufacturers are focusing on enhancing the performance of retort films to meet various regulatory standards while ensuring they remain cost-effective for widespread use.

By Ingredient Type

Nylon 6:

Nylon 6 is a popular ingredient used in the production of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films due to its excellent mechanical properties and versatility. This ingredient provides films with high tensile strength and flexibility, making them suitable for various applications, including food and medical packaging. The polymer's ability to withstand high temperatures and its resistance to chemicals further enhances its usability in industrial settings. Manufacturers often choose Nylon 6 for its cost-effectiveness and its ability to be processed using different techniques, allowing for the creation of tailored packaging solutions that meet specific performance requirements.

Nylon 66:

Nylon 66 is another key ingredient utilized in the production of BOPA films, known for its superior strength and thermal resistance. This ingredient is particularly favored in applications that require enhanced barrier properties and stability under challenging conditions. Nylon 66 films are often used in high-end packaging solutions for pharmaceuticals and food products that require long shelf lives and protection from environmental factors. The robustness of Nylon 66 also allows for thinner films without compromising performance, aligning with the industry's trend towards lighter and more sustainable packaging solutions.

Nylon 12:

Nylon 12 is less commonly used than Nylon 6 and Nylon 66 but offers unique properties that make it attractive for certain applications. Its lower density and excellent flexibility provide films that are lightweight yet durable, making them suitable for consumer goods packaging where aesthetics and performance are crucial. Nylon 12 films exhibit significant resistance to moisture and chemicals, which is advantageous in medical packaging applications. As the market increasingly demands innovative solutions, Nylon 12 is gaining attention for its potential applications in niche markets that require specialized performance characteristics.

By Region

The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to dominate the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films market due to rapid industrialization and urbanization. Countries such as China and India are major contributors to this growth, driven by their extensive food packaging and consumer goods industries. The increasing population and changing lifestyles are leading to a higher demand for packaged goods, thereby propelling the use of BOPA films. Additionally, the region is experiencing significant investments in the packaging sector, with manufacturers focusing on adopting advanced technologies to improve production efficiency and film quality. The CAGR for the Asia Pacific region is expected to be around 7.5%, highlighting its importance as a growth driver in the global market.

North America is another significant market for BOPA films, with a focus on food and medical packaging applications. The region's stringent regulatory standards for food safety and packaging materials are pushing manufacturers to adopt high-quality BOPA films that meet these requirements. The growing trend towards sustainability in packaging is also influencing market dynamics, as companies seek eco-friendly solutions. While the North American market is mature, it still presents opportunities for innovation and growth, especially in the development of advanced packaging materials that cater to the evolving preferences of consumers. The market in this region is expected to grow at a CAGR of 5.2% during the forecast period.

Threats

Despite the promising outlook for the Biaxially Oriented Polyamide Laminating Films market, several threats could hinder growth. One of the main challenges is the fluctuating prices of raw materials, particularly polyamide resins, which can significantly impact production costs. Variability in supply due to geopolitical factors or changes in trade policies can lead to increased manufacturing expenses, forcing companies to either absorb these costs or pass them onto consumers, potentially affecting demand. Additionally, the presence of substitutes, such as other polymers that offer similar properties at lower costs, poses a threat to market share. As manufacturers explore alternative materials to meet sustainability goals, the competitive landscape could shift, posing challenges for established BOPA film manufacturers.

Regulatory challenges also present hurdles for the industry. As governments worldwide implement stricter regulations around packaging materials, companies must ensure compliance with a growing number of standards, which may require significant investment in testing and certification. The complexity of navigating these regulations can be burdensome, particularly for smaller companies that may lack the resources to adapt quickly. Furthermore, the increasing emphasis on recycling and sustainability in packaging could pressure BOPA film manufacturers to innovate rapidly in order to maintain market relevance.
